Feature Einband Einstand
Definition die drei schützenden Teile eines Buches: zwei Deckel (für Vorder- und Rückseite) und der Buchrücken Beginn der Tätigkeit an einem neuen Wirkungsort, meist einer Arbeitsstelle

Spelling & Dictionary Insight

A purely visual mix-up. Einband ([ˈaɪ̯nˌbant]) and Einstand ([ˈaɪ̯nˌʃtant]) are said differently, so reading them aloud is the quickest way to catch the wrong one.
